This week, we look at professional labs which send prints directly to the photographer for framing and delivery to the end customer. The advantage over the hands-off fulfillment offered by other sites is that you get to see your work (and correct errors) before the customer does. Read more

The 21st annual Vermont Open Studio Weekend is Memorial Day Weekend. The statewide celebration gives you an inside look at some 300 Vermont artists and craftspeople working in their studios. 11 are right here.
